Concordia underdogs going into season

If you take a look at the women’s hockey team’s roster for the 2006-07 season, you may find yourself searching for names you recognize.

Gone from the team are Janie Brassard, Dominique Rancour, Jodi Gosse, Marie-Pier Cantin-Drouin and Cecilia Anderson, among others. But the Stinger still have a solid group of players on the team headed into the season.

Newly appointed captain Andrea Dolan along with alternates Sophie Beaudry, Angela Di Stasi and Rose Healy will provide the leadership along with returning players like Tawnya Danis, Isabelle Caron, Esther Latoures, Victoria Johnstone, Meggy Hatin-Leveillee and last year’s team rookie of the year Mary-Jane O’Shea.

“We’re a very young team, so we need to take baby steps,” said Les Lawton the head coach of the Stingers. “We lost a lot of players, but every year you lose good players. I’m enthused about this season, I think we’re going to battle,” he said.
